Printer HP DesignJet T650

The HP DesignJet T650 printer is an innovative model designed to meet the needs of printing professionals. With its thermal inkjet printing technology, it offers exceptional print quality thanks to a maximum resolution of 2400 x 1200 DPI, ideal for technical documents and colorful posters.

This model has color printing capability and uses four cartridges (Black, Cyan, Magenta, Yellow) to ensure vibrant and accurate results. The HP DesignJet T650 is also equipped with color scanning and copying features, allowing for precise reproductions of your documents.

Its paper handling is versatile, supporting various types of media from standard paper to photo paper, and can print up to a maximum size of 914 x 1897 mm. In terms of connectivity, the printer supports Wi-Fi, USB port, and Ethernet/LAN, ensuring easy integration into your network.

The DesignJet T650 features a modern black design, with a built-in screen that makes it easy to use. It is also designed to be environmentally friendly, holding sustainability certifications such as EPEAT Gold and ENERGY STAR.

In summary, the HP DesignJet T650 printer is an ideal choice for those seeking a professional printing solution, combining quality, connectivity, and sustainability.

Editorial note

The HP DesignJet T650 printer stands out for its exceptional printing performance, offering a maximum resolution of 2400 x 1200 DPI, ideal for professional documents and detailed images. Its versatility in printing media, including photo paper and glossy paper, as well as its color scanning and copying features, enhances its appeal to users looking for faithful and vibrant reproductions. However, despite its many advantages, this model has some drawbacks. Its weight of 35.4 kg can complicate its movement and installation, particularly in tight spaces. Additionally, the costs of ink cartridges can be high in the long run, representing a significant investment. Its large size can also pose integration issues in some offices. In terms of ergonomics, the user experience is generally positive, although the interface may seem complex for some, requiring an adjustment period. Connectivity is enhanced by Ethernet, Wi-Fi, and USB options, but the lack of Bluetooth could limit usage flexibility for some users. Finally, the provided documentation is comprehensive and helpful, facilitating product handling. Sustainability certifications, such as EPEAT Gold and ENERGY STAR, attest to HP's commitment to responsible energy consumption and environmental respect. In summary, the HP DesignJet T650 is a robust and high-performing printer, well-suited to professional printing needs, but it requires consideration of its integration and operating costs.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the weight of the HP DesignJet T650?
The weight of the HP DesignJet T650 is 35400 g.
What is the recommended method for removing jammed paper from the printer?
To remove jammed paper, it is advisable to proceed gently. Turn off the printer and check that the print head is not on the paper and that no debris remains inside.
Why is my printer not recognizing the original cartridges?
Non-authentic cartridges may not be recognized by the printer. In this case, a message may appear indicating that the cartridge is empty. The cartridge manual usually contains solutions; if the problem persists, it is recommended to contact the seller.
What could be the reasons for poor print quality?
Poor print quality can be due to several factors. Ensure that the cartridges or toners are filled. Inkjet printers often require cleaning, cartridges may be dry, or the print head may be damaged. For laser printers, calibration is often advised.
What are the differences between a laser printer and an inkjet printer?
A laser printer uses toner while an inkjet printer operates with ink.
Why is my inkjet printer producing black streaks?
Generally, black streaks indicate that the inkjet printer cartridge is damaged and needs to be replaced.
What does the term DPI mean?
DPI stands for Dots Per Inch, which indicates the number of ink droplets deposited on the paper during printing.

Why won't my printer turn on?
Check that the power cable is properly connected to the printer and the wall outlet. Also, ensure that the power switch at the back of the printer is in the 'ON' position.
How do I load paper into the HP DesignJet T650 printer?
To load paper, open the input tray and ensure it is fully extended. Adjust the guides according to the paper size, place the paper in the tray, and slide it until it stops. Then, tighten the guides against the edges of the paper.
What should I do if the print quality is unsatisfactory?
Check that the ink cartridges are properly installed and sufficiently filled. Perform an alignment and cleaning of the print heads to ensure optimal quality. If this does not resolve the issue, consider replacing the cartridges or cleaning the print heads more thoroughly.
How do I connect the printer to my computer?
Ensure that both the printer and the computer are turned on. Connect them using a USB cable, making sure to insert it correctly into the appropriate ports. Once connected, your computer should automatically detect the printer and install the necessary drivers. If this does not happen, you may need to download the drivers from the HP website.
What should I do if an error message appears on the printer?
Take note of the error message displayed and consult the troubleshooting section of the printer manual for instructions. Many common error messages provide specific solutions. If the problem persists, contacting technical support or customer service may be necessary.
